The River Cam is a small river in Gloucestershire, England.It flows for 12 miles (20 km) eastwards into the Gloucester and Sharpness Canal.. The river rises on the Cotswold escarpment above the village of Uley, and flows through Dursley, Cam and Cambridge to the Gloucester and Sharpness Canal as a feeder to that waterway. The stretch above Jesus Lock is sometimes known as the middle river (with the section above the Mill Pond being referred to as the upper river).
